Computing Phonon Contributions to Heat Transfer (IMAGE)
Caption
Asegun Henry and his group at Georgia Tech have developed a new formalism called the Green-Kubo Modal Analysis (GKMA) method that allows one to calculate the modal contributions to thermal conductivity for any material or object where the atoms vibrate around equilibrium sites. They are currently applying the method to amorphous materials like glass.
